Checking seat availability on united.com
I had been assigned aisle seats for an upcoming flight due to the lack of availability of window seats. The day before my departure, I visited united.com and proceeded to go through the mock steps of purchasing a ticket on the flight I was booked on just to use the "select seat" option to view empty and occupied seats.
I found that the seat I was assigned was appearing as available. I also saw that the window seat I would have liked (8A) was appearing as occupied. I called res anyway to request a seat change. The agent was able to give me the window seat (8A) which according to the seat map was already occupied. Is the seat map feature on united.com reliable? koppelman |
Is it a 777?
If so, sometimes 8A and 8B are blocked as crew rests and are only released closer to departure. ------------------ Latitudes. For my part, I travel not to go anywhere, but to go.
